    Good Food

    Jacques Pepin; Italian Renaissance Cooking; Farmers’ Market Dilemma

    Howell Tumlin cultivates support for the Southland’s Farmers Markets; Jonathan Gold shares his latest restaurant pick; renowned chef, Jacques Pepin, celebrates Mother’s Day with a recipe just for Mom; Eric Muller brings science into the kitchen with some fun and simple experiments; travel to Italy with Dave Dewitt, who traces the history of Italian cooking during the Renaissance, and Mark Schatzker, who reports on his journey along Italy’s Amalfi coast; Andrew Smith documents American food culture in his book, The Oxford Companion to American Food and Drink; and Laura Avery finds what’s fresh in the Market Report.

      The Market Report

      Laura Avery talks with a boutique grower of highly flavorful fruit from Reedley, California. Fitz Kelly has the season's first ripe nectarines and peaches as well as some delicious apriums, a cross between an apricot and a plum.

      Kitchen Science

      Science educator, Eric Muller, creates fun kitchen experiments using everyday objects.  In the experiment du jour, Evan and Eric create sounds with a turkey baster and bend water using static electricity.
